Electrical Engineering Study Program students together with lecturers and alumni made an industrial visit to the SIGURA-GURA PLTA PT. INALUM with the main aim of providing direct understanding to students about the process of generating electricity from water energy sources. Students will see firsthand how water is converted into electrical energy through hydropower processes, including the process of storing water, building dams, regulating water flow, and converting kinetic energy into electricity. By understanding the main objective of this service activity, it is hoped that a visit to the PLTA can provide a useful experience for electrical engineering students at Darma Agung University in understanding the role of renewable energy in sustainable development and increasing their awareness of global environmental issues.
